Harvey K. Littleton (WI/NC, 1922-2013), Pink Sliced Descending Form
Lot Details & Additional Photographs
1989, cased glass in clear, pink, lavender, purple and coral, cut and polished ends, signed "Harvey K. Littleton, 12-1989-10" mounted to a white acrylic stand set atop a custom mahogany plinth.

Larger glass 13.5 x 10 x 4 in.; DOA 51 x 24 x 16 in.

Often cited as the founder of the studio glass movement, two works by Harvey Littleton were the first examples of modern glasswork acquired by the Metropolitan Museum of Art, NY. After a long and successful tenure on the faculty of the University of Wisconsin, Littleton settled in Spruce Pine, NC.
